As the vice-president of research at Sudbury Regional Hospital, he hopes to collaborate with larger medical centres during the clinical trials.
"Hospitals and clinics will apply to perform the procedure in a very controlled way. They will follow patients to see if they've improved or not and that way, we'll have an answer," he said, adding that the first step for researchers is to submit a proposal to the Canadian Institutes of Health Research. According to Dr. Diaz-Mitoma, the trials will probably start in about six to eight months
